Forum Discussion

Dr_ViiRuS's avatar
12 years ago

Help ! BF4 crash Fault Module: MSVCR110.dll

I have this crash alot

and always it has the same fault module name : MSVCR110.dll

this is full details

Problem signature:
  Problem Event Name:    APPCRASH
  Application Name:    bf4_x86.exe
  Application Version:    1.0.0.0
  Application Timestamp:    526b90bd
  Fault Module Name:    MSVCR110.dll
  Fault Module Version:    11.0.51106.1
  Fault Module Timestamp:    5098858e
  Exception Code:    c0000005
  Exception Offset:    0000e12c
  OS Version:    6.3.9600.2.0.0.256.48
  Locale ID:    3073
  Additional Information 1:    5861
  Additional Information 2:    5861822e1919d7c014bbb064c64908b2
  Additional Information 3:    2af1
  Additional Information 4:    2af1ed6f1bdf9836b314522e3dfa0012

ANY HELP ?!!

12 Replies

  • Thanks for your suggestion, but have already tried all of that. Runs off ssd, so no defrag - TRIM is enabled. Have CCleaner, have uninstalled reinstalled. All Windows 7 64 bit files are up to date and Graphic Drivers are up to date. Anti-virus is Microsoft Security Essentials - can turn off but don't think this is the problem.

    Again, it's to do with MS Visual Studio Dynamic Link Library. The dependencies for the code get broken when you run other programs, but I run the VCredistributable before playing. This should fix the problem as it should sets up the right dependencies for BF4. Still doesn't seem to work.

  • I think I may have fixed it!

    I was forcing the game to run in X86 (32 Bit mode). I forgot I had specified this option in Origin. If you go to MY Games in Origin and click on BF4. Next to Launch Options, click edit. You can force it to run X86 or X64. [img]http://i.imgur.com/yyfVAir.png[/img]

    Better to run it in X64 if you have a 64 Bit OS.

    Then go to "C:\Program Files (x86)\Origin Games\Battlefield 4\__Installer\vc\vc2012Update3\

    Scratch that, there is a newer update of visual studio 2012 redistributable that fixes some issues (I was still having crashes). You can download is here:

    http://www.microsoft.com/en-au/download/details.aspx?id=30679

    Run the vcredist_x64 before you play the game - this ensures the correct dll dependencies are set up.

    If you have a 32 Bit OS, run the vcredist_x86 - (same link) - http://www.microsoft.com/en-au/download/details.aspx?id=30679

    As long as you run the redistributable first that matches the correct mode that use, you should be good.

About Battlefield Franchise Discussion

Discuss the Battlefield games in this community forum.133,572 PostsLatest Activity: 3 days ago